软件下载网站哪个比较好,广告设计与制作学啥,找人建个网站多少钱,山东网站建设口碑好冒泡排序原理 每次比较两个相邻的元素#xff0c;将较大的元素交换至右端 冒泡排序执行过程输出效果 冒泡排序实现思路
每次冒泡排序操作都会将相邻的两个元素进行比较#xff0c;看是否满足大小关系要求#xff0c;如果不满足#xff0c;就交换这两个相邻元素的次序… 冒泡排序原理 每次比较两个相邻的元素将较大的元素交换至右端 冒泡排序执行过程输出效果 冒泡排序实现思路
每次冒泡排序操作都会将相邻的两个元素进行比较看是否满足大小关系要求如果不满足就交换这两个相邻元素的次序一次冒泡至少让一个元素移动到它应该排列的位置重复N次就完成了冒泡排序
冒泡排序代码 $array[2,31,4,6,1,8,21,34,23];for($i0; $icount($array)-1; $i){for($ij0; $ijcount($array)-1-$i; $ij){if ($array[$ij] $array[$ij1]){$temp $array[$ij];$array[$ij]$array[$ij1];$array[$ij1]$temp;}}}